Rasagiline improves polysomnographic sleep parameters in patients with Parkinson's disease: a double-blind, baseline-controlled trial.

Wiebke HermannM FauserM WieneckeS BrownA MaaßC OssigK OttoM D BrandtM LöhleU SchwanebeckX GraehlertH ReichmannAlexander Storch
Published in: European journal of neurology (2018)
In patients with PD with sleep disturbances, rasagiline showed beneficial effects on sleep quality as measured by polysomnography. These effects were probably not related to motor improvement or translated into improved overall sleep quality perception by patients.
